What you’ll actually do

This role exists to remove friction, manage detail, and create consistency across everything we deliver.

You’ll be the operational glue that keeps programmes, events and communications running smoothly.

You’ll support with:

Programme & Event Support

  • Coordinating logistics for workshops and events (venues, materials, schedules, speakers)
  • Preparing agendas, packs and checklists
  • Supporting in-person events during busy delivery periods

Participant & Member Experience

  • Onboarding participants (docs, access, calendars, comms)
  • Being a friendly, professional point of contact
  • Making sure every interaction feels organised, calm and considered

Administration & Documentation

  • Maintaining trackers, shared folders and documentation
  • Preparing presentations, reports and materials
  • Ensuring everything is accurate, up to date and easy to find

Operational Follow-Through

  • Tracking tasks and actions so nothing slips
  • Flagging issues early (not reactively)
  • Continuously improving how we work
